Overview Servokit 150mg/1000mg/1000mg Tablet
Tri-Comb 150mg/1000mg/1000mg tablets offer a combined approach to managing vaginal infections. This medication combats infection by inhibiting the growth and eliminating existing microorganisms. For optimal blood levels, consistent daily dosing at the same time is recommended. Missed doses should be taken promptly upon recall; avoid skipping doses and complete the prescribed course, even with symptom improvement. Discontinuing treatment without consulting a physician may exacerbate symptoms. Potential side effects include nausea, headache, vomiting, altered taste, dizziness, indigestion, appetite loss, and abdominal discomfort. Diarrhea is possible; increased fluid intake is advised to prevent dehydration.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any existing health conditions, current medications, and any known allergies to the medication's ingredients.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should seek medical advice before use.

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Ingestion of alcohol alongside Servokit 150mg/1000mg/1000mg tablets can lead to adverse effects including facial flushing, tachycardia, queasiness, dehydration, pectoral pain, and hypotension (a disulfiram-like response).
